Frequently Asked Questions About Drug Detox in Youngstown

How long does drug detox typically last in Youngstown?

The duration of drug detox in Youngstown, as in any location, can vary based on factors such as the type of drug, the individual's metabolism, and the severity of addiction. Generally, the acute phase of detox, where withdrawal symptoms are most intense, lasts around 3 to 7 days. However, the overall detox process and recovery can extend to several weeks or even months as individuals work through physical and psychological changes.

What are common withdrawal symptoms during drug detox in Youngstown?

Withdrawal symptoms during drug detox in Youngstown, similar to other places, vary depending on the specific substance. Common symptoms include nausea, vomiting, anxiety, sweating, insomnia, muscle aches, and irritability. Severe cases may experience hallucinations, seizures, or delirium tremens. Medical supervision and support are crucial during this period to manage and alleviate these symptoms.

Is it safe to detox from drugs without medical supervision in Youngstown?

Detoxing from drugs without medical supervision in Youngstown, as anywhere else, can be dangerous. This is especially true for individuals with a history of severe addiction or certain health conditions. The withdrawal symptoms can be intense and potentially life-threatening. Medical professionals in Youngstown can provide necessary support, medication, and monitoring to ensure a safer detox process and minimize health risks.

What is the role of medications in drug detox in Youngstown?

Medications may play a crucial role in drug detox in Youngstown by helping to manage withdrawal symptoms and reduce cravings. They can alleviate discomfort and decrease the risk of severe complications during the detox process. Medical professionals in Youngstown may prescribe specific medications tailored to the individual's needs, helping them transition more smoothly into recovery.

Can drug detox be done at home in Youngstown?

While some individuals may attempt drug detox at home in Youngstown, it's generally not recommended. This is especially true for substances with severe withdrawal symptoms. Medical facilities in Youngstown may provide a safer and more controlled environment with medical professionals who can manage complications. Attempting detox at home can lead to serious health risks, inadequate support, and a higher likelihood of relapse.

How does drug detox fit into the overall addiction treatment process in Youngstown?

Drug detox is often the initial step in the addiction treatment process in Youngstown, just like in other locations. It focuses on clearing the body of the substance and managing withdrawal symptoms. Following detox, individuals in Youngstown may typically transition into comprehensive addiction treatment programs that address the underlying causes of addiction, provide counseling, therapy, and support to promote lasting recovery. Detox sets the foundation for a successful journey towards a substance-free life in Youngstown.
